
What is recorded here
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Cupar, Kirkgate, Old and St Michael of Tarvit Parish Church as Church (15th Century).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
St Michael of Tarvit Parish Church is linked to St Michael, a widely venerated Christian saint associated with protection and healing. While specific local cures or rituals at this site are not well documented, St Michael was traditionally invoked for defense against illness and spiritual harm in Scottish folklore.
